A "teskedar" (tsp) is a Swedish unit of volume, specifically a teaspoon. It is a relatively small unit, commonly used in cooking and baking, as well as for measuring liquid medications. While not part of the International System of Units (SI), it remains a practical unit in everyday life, particularly in Sweden and other Scandinavian countries.
The "teskedar" has its roots in the traditional practice of using household items for measurement. Before standardized measuring tools became widely available, people often relied on common objects like spoons to estimate quantities. The size of a teaspoon could vary slightly depending on the region and the specific spoon, but over time, a standardized value was established for culinary and pharmaceutical purposes.

Kilolitres (kL) are a common unit for measuring relatively large volumes of liquids. Let's explore what a kilolitre represents, how it relates to other units, and some examples of its use.
A kilolitre is a unit of volume in the metric system. The prefix "kilo" indicates a factor of 1000. Therefore, one kilolitre is equal to 1000 litres.
Relationship to other units: A litre (L) is defined as the volume of a cube that is 10 centimeters on each side.
